CIMS

Cancer Information Management System

At present information for clinical decision making, treatment implementation and administrative monitoring of the service comes from many different sources and collation of this involves a great deal of staff time and is often inefficient to the detriment of excellent integrated patient care.

This can be resolved by the development and implementation of a Cancer Information Management System (CIMS) for the Trust. CIMS will provide system support for Multi-Disciplinary teams (MDT) and enable National Cancer Waiting Times reporting of the new targets given in the Cancer Reform Strategy

The Cancer Information Management System will enable:

Clinicians and administrative teams to manage cancer patients within increasingly complex, cross site meetings.

Fulfilment of current and future national performance requirements for cancer.

Collection of data to judge clinical performance

Core Benefits of the system

Provides an integrated MDT solution for the Trust, improving cross site communication and making better use of Trust resources

Captures all Cancer Waiting Times reporting in a single solution.

Allows for further extension to other sites, and possibly throughout the rest of London
